Meaning & usage

adj/ˈbɹɑː.si/Australia, General-South-African, New-Zealand, UK/ˈbɹæs.i/Australia, General-South-African, New-Zealand, UK/ˈbɹæs.i/Canada, US
  1. Resembling brass.

    The cup had a brassy color.
  2. Impudent; impudently bold.

    informal
    Don’t get brassy with me, young lady!
  3. Unfeeling; pitiless.

  4. Harsh in tone.

    an organ stop with a brassy tone
Where this word comes from

From brass + -y (suffix forming adjectives meaning “having the quality of”).
